The library uses strict semver; ceremony tooling must run against the exact minor pinned (currently 4.x), never latest, since signing widgets changed between minors. Record the resolved version in the ceremony log before proceeding. If the manifest and lockfile disagree, abort and escalate. The signing material for this step sits in a sealed keystore maintained by the Fenwick ops group. Unseal it with the recovery passphrase shown immediately below.

unlock words, hahip-yagef: zorok-novmir-zorix-silax

The Orvane Labs bike cage and the east and west parking gates operate on separate access schedules, and facilities desk staff should note that visitor vehicles may only use the west gate between 07:00 and 19:00. Cyclists requesting cage access must show a valid day pass, and their details should be entered in the access ledger before the cage is opened. Gates must never be propped open, even briefly, during deliveries. When a manual override is required at either gate, use the code below.

staff pass of fadup-fawig = bdg-FUNKS-4

The dispatch model now separates passenger arrival generation from car assignment, which lets us replay recorded traffic against candidate algorithms deterministically. For this release we freeze the arrival model and vary only assignment heuristics, so regressions in wait-time percentiles can be attributed cleanly. The release manager should note that any change to the constants below invalidates prior benchmark baselines, so they are versioned with the build and must not be edited post-cut. The frozen tuning constants are:

tuning constants:
RATE_LIMITS = {
    "goriel": 284,
    "brieth": 236,
    "lamvan": 916,
    "druok": 255,
    "wenion": 979,
    "istmir": 343,
    "queniel": 302,
}